About Avail Car Sharing

Avail car sharing is on a mission to shape the future of transportation, and we’re starting by offering self-service car sharing throughout Chicago and Denver. Borrowers have easy access to a variety of reliable and affordable vehicles in convenient neighborhood locations. Owners get a passive way to earn extra income and derive more value from an expensive asset when they don’t need to drive.

 

Avail is proud to be a part of Allstate’s family of companies since 2018, enabling better transportation options for the communities we’re in.

Interview

When and how did you get your start in marketing?

During my freshman year of college, I took the course catalog and flipped through every single page and highlighted the courses that sounded the most interesting. While we didn’t have a marketing major itself, the courses I was most interested in were marketing focused and so that started me on my journey!

 

What brings you joy in your role?

I love being able to collaborate with my peers on other teams (product, engineering, customer service, etc) to make sure all their needs are met throughout the customer’s lifecycle journey. In my role, I get to help strategize but also get into the weeds to implement and execute on, and that balance keeps me on my toes, allowing me to constantly work to improve the customer experience!

 

What tips, tricks, or pieces of advice would give a new Iterable user?

The support documentation is super helpful and provides great step-by-step instructions on how to do a lot of different things within Iterable. When I can’t figure out how to do something, I always check there first for help!

 

What does customer experience mean to you, and how does Iterable play a role?

The customer experience is mission critical to any successful business because repeat customers, retention and positive word-of-mouth are the key to success.

We use Iterable for all of our timely transactional customer facing messaging to make sure they have all the necessary details needed for their trip to allow for as seamless of a trip as possible, in turn generating a positive customer experience.

 

As a consumer, what brings you joy from a brand’s outreach/communication?

I love when the content is customized to me. When I get an email from a brand and it includes relevant products based on past purchases or searches, I feel more connected to the brand vs when I receive irrelevant emails even though the brand has plenty of data on me.

 

Besides Iterable, what are the other tools in your marketing toolkit that you can’t live without?

We use Segment as our CDP which allows us to trigger comms in Iterable. Without it, we would lack all the personalized content we are able to include based on our customers’ actions.
